Inside the mad world of an under-six cyclocross race (video)
On-board footage captures some great cross skills in the under-six boys and girls race from the Ulster Cyclocross series

The Vuelta a Espana? Forget it. The world championships? Don't even bother. Because this is surely the best on-board footage from a race yet, as we're taken inside the under-six race from the Ulster Cyclocross Series round two.
Youtube user Gary McKeegan uploaded the footage from the race which took place last Sunday in Sir Thomas and Lady Dixon Park, Belfast, with the video showing some pretty awesome skills from the kids involved in what looks like quite a frantic race.
34 youngsters took part in the race, making two laps round a short circuit, with Rhys Hepburn (Island Wheelers) taking the win ahead of Emer Heverin (Castlereagh CC) in second and Patrick Elliott (Carn Wheelers) in third.
